Monocrystalline vs Polycrystalline Solar Panels

To work out how much electricity a solar panel will generate for your home we need to multiply the number of sunshine hours by the power output of the solar panel. For example, in the case of a 300 W solar panel, we would calculate 4.5 x 300 (sunlight hours x power output) which equals 1,350 watt-hours (Wh) or 1.35 kWh.

The 3 Different Types of Solar Power Systems Explained

There are three basic types of solar power systems: grid-tie, off-grid, and backup power systems. Here''s a quick summary of the differences between them: Off-grid solar is designed to bring power to remote locations where there is no grid access. Off-grid systems require a battery bank to store the energy your panels produce.

Photovoltaic effect

Mafate Marla solar panel . The photovoltaic effect is the generation of voltage and electric current in a material upon exposure to light is a physical phenomenon. [1]The photovoltaic effect is closely related to the photoelectric effect.For both phenomena, light is absorbed, causing excitation of an electron or other charge carrier to a higher-energy state.
